Premium Content Subscriber only A flock of black cockatoos perched above as community members gathered at Mackay Harbour to celebrate a vision to protect the Great Barrier Reef. From Finch Hatton to Slade Point, more than 50 residents were at the launch of Reef Catchments Community Action Plan which covers the Mackay Isaac Whitsunday region. CEO Katrina Dent said it was created from a groundswell of ideas from the community about what were the priorities for (their) neck of the woods when it came to the reef. Ms Dent said funding from the Great Barrier Reef Foundation had allowed Reef Catchments to develop a road map to carry out the community s proposals. ....

The social inequality and stigma afflicting the LGBTQ+ and TGNC (transgender and gender non-conforming) populations in Chicago creates a health-care quandary; they’re more susceptible to issues such as HIV, cancer, and suicide, yet less likely to receive care. Nationally, LGBT youth are two to three times more likely to attempt suicide, gay men are at higher risk for HIV and other STDs, and transgender individuals have a higher prevalence of mental health issues, HIV/STDs, suicide, and less access to health insurance, according to the CDC. ....
